The Project

A prominent fuel and energy supplier in the Asia-Pacific region partnered with Lacima to enhance its risk management framework and leverage advanced analytics for the accurate valuation and assessment of risk across its energy trading activities. This project extended an existing relationship in which Lacima Analytics was already in use for portfolio-level valuation and market risk management.

The Client

Our client is a leading integrated fuel and energy business operating across the Asia-Pacific, supplying fuels, lubricants, and convenience products to a wide range of customers. With a large retail network and key refining and trading operations, the business serves millions of customers weekly and operates across international markets, including New Zealand and the Philippines, with trading hubs in Singapore and the United States. As a publicly listed company, it has set ambitious sustainability goals, including achieving net zero emissions by 2040, and is expanding its asset portfolio to include retail electricity and renewable energy investments.

The Challenge

Our client required a comprehensive solution to manage valuation and risk exposure across a diverse portfolio that includes both financial energy contracts and physical trading activities. Lacima Analytics had already been adopted as a core risk and valuation platform, and our client sought to expand its use with additional functionality and to embed best-practice standards within its risk governance framework.

To support this evolution, they engaged our consulting services to enhance their overall risk management framework, including quantitative modelling, model calibration, and the integration of analytics with operational reporting and decision-making.

The Solution

Portfolio Valuation and Risk Modelling

Our client utilises Lacima Analytics’ Market Risk modules, including Value-at-Risk (VaR) and Earnings-at-Risk (EaR), together with Valuation modules to assess risk and value across its energy trading portfolio. An additional stress testing module adds further robustness by enabling risk exposure analysis under various market scenarios.

Consulting and Risk Framework Enhancement

Lacima provided strategic consulting support to help develop and refine our client’s risk framework. This included the development and calibration of quantitative models, guidance on data integration (Extract, Transform, Load) processes, and interpretation of analytical outputs.

Lacima also reviewed and optimised the existing configuration of our client’s Lacima Analytics environment to ensure alignment with their evolving risk limits, governance policies, and business priorities.

The overarching goal was to establish a consistent and resilient risk management lifecycle, underpinned by best practices.

The Outcome

With Lacima Analytics, our client has enhanced its risk and valuation capabilities and practices, enabling more accurate oversight of financial contracts, physical trades, and renewable energy assets within their portfolio. The enhanced framework supports greater transparency and alignment with their long-term growth and sustainability goals.
